Do you have a job that you do every week for the same client?
It gets pretty repetitive to have to create that same job in GeoOp over and over again. That's where Recurring Jobs comes in.
Now you can set up a recurring job so that you only need to set up that job once and continue to keep up with it more easily.
Recurring Jobs can be set up by first creating a Job Template.
- Go to Jobs > Job Templates, then click on the template you want to use. From the next screen, Edit Template, click the Recurrence tab. Make sure the Template has a Client and a Visit, or you will not see the Recurrence tab.
- Select the required Recurrence Pattern from the drop-down, which will give you further tailored options.
- Select the Start Date for the sequence and your end date settings. Please read the note below for more information on this.
- When done, click Create Jobs.
Important Note: The dates or days of the week you set for the Visit in the Job Template don't affect what dates the recurring Jobs occur on. The Recurrence Pattern determines what date and day of the week Visits within recurring Jobs occur. The time on a Visit in the Job Templates, however, is used for the recurring Jobs.
However, if there is more than one Visit, then the dates set on the Visits impact the recurring Jobs, i.e., if a Job Template has 2 Visits that are 3 days apart, and you select the recurrence pattern to create Jobs for a Monday, then the Jobs will be created with one Visit on a Monday, and another Visit 3 days after on Thursday, both under a single Job.
Important information regarding recurrence end dates
End-date settings are very important and should be considered carefully when creating recurring Jobs. There is also the option of selecting 'No End Date' on the recurrence limit for these types of jobs.
The creation of recurring Jobs can be configured further by going to your Company Account settings called 'Recurrence Limit (Days)'. This limit defines how far in advance you would like the Job on a recurrence to be created, and hence visible on your Schedule and Job lists. Please set this limit appropriately for your workflow.
Canceled Jobs created by the recurrence
Simply delete the Job Template the recurrence is generated from, and any Jobs that have not yet occurred (forward of the current date), will be deleted from your Scheduler / Job list.
